Here are 3 skincare ingredients worth knowing if you're looking to manage blemishes, congestion and post-breakout concerns.

1. Salicylic Acid

Salicylic acid remains one of the most trusted ingredients for blemish-prone skin. As a beta-hydroxy acid (BHA), it works by penetrating deep into pores to help dissolve excess oil, remove dead skin cells and reduce congestion.

This makes it particularly beneficial for those struggling with blackheads, whiteheads and recurring breakouts. In addition to its exfoliating properties, salicylic acid can help minimise the appearance of redness and support a clearer-looking complexion over time.

For those introducing acids into their routine, gradual use is often the best approach to help skin adjust comfortably.

2. Niacinamide

Niacinamide, also known as vitamin B3, is a versatile ingredient that offers multiple benefits for acne-prone skin. It helps strengthen the skin barrier, balance excess oil production and soothe the appearance of irritation.

Its calming properties make it especially useful for skin that appears red or stressed following breakouts. Niacinamide can also help improve the appearance of uneven skin tone and post-blemish hyperpigmentation, making it a valuable addition.

One of its greatest advantages is its compatibility with other active ingredients, allowing it to work seamlessly within a comprehensive skincare regimen.

3. Retinol and Retinoids

Vitamin A derivatives, including retinol and retinoids, are widely recognised for their ability to support skin renewal. By encouraging faster cell turnover, they help reduce pore congestion and improve the appearance of blemish-prone skin.

Retinol can also help smooth skin texture and minimise the visible effects of post-acne marks, making it a popular choice for those seeking both clearer and more refined-looking skin.

As with any active ingredient, consistency is key. Introducing retinol gradually and pairing it with daily sun protection can help maximise results while maintaining skin comfort.

 

Building the Right Routine for Your Skin

Managing acne isn't about using the strongest products possible, it's about finding the right balance of ingredients for your skin's unique needs.

Every skin is different, and factors such as skin type, lifestyle, hormones and environmental stressors can all influence breakouts. A personalised approach that combines targeted actives with hydration and barrier support often delivers the most effective long-term results.
